[errors] drivers/block/skd_main.c:441:3: error: implicit declaration of function 'readq' [-Werror=implicit-function-declaration] drivers/block/skd_main.c:455:3: error: implicit declaration of function 'writeq' [-Werror=implicit-function-declaration] az6027.c:(.text+0x1ee857): undefined reference to `stb0899_attach' az6027.c:(.text+0x1ee877): undefined reference to `stb6100_attach' cxusb.c:(.text+0x1f5b7f): undefined reference to `dib7000p_get_i2c_master' cxusb.c:(.text+0x1f5c62): undefined reference to `dib7000p_set_wbd_ref' cxusb.c:(.text+0x1f5c89): undefined reference to `dib7000p_set_gpio' cxusb.c:(.text+0x1f6500): undefined reference to `dib7000p_i2c_enumeration' fs/sysfs/mount.c:110:8: error: 'type' undeclared (first use in this function) include/linux/sysfs.h:428:1: error: expected identifier or '(' before '{' token ERROR: "sysfs_get_dirent_ns" [drivers/md/md-mod.ko] undefined! [warnings] drivers/media/pci/zoran/zoran_device.c:451:3: warning: 'virt_to_bus' is deprecated (declared at arch/alpha/include/asm/io.h:114) [-Wdeprecated-declarations] drivers/media/pci/zoran/zoran_device.c:453:3: warning: 'virt_to_bus' is deprecated (declared at arch/alpha/include/asm/io.h:114) [-Wdeprecated-declarations] drivers/media/pci/zoran/zoran_device.c:796:2: warning: 'virt_to_bus' is deprecated (declared at arch/alpha/include/asm/io.h:114) [-Wdeprecated-declarations] drivers/media/pci/zoran/zoran_driver.c:241:3: warning: 'virt_to_bus' is deprecated (declared at arch/alpha/include/asm/io.h:114) [-Wdeprecated-declarations] drivers/media/pci/zoran/zoran_driver.c:245:3: warning: 'virt_to_bus' is deprecated (declared at arch/alpha/include/asm/io.h:114) [-Wdeprecated-declarations] drivers/media/pci/zoran/zoran_driver.c:334:3: warning: 'virt_to_bus' is deprecated (declared at arch/alpha/include/asm/io.h:114) [-Wdeprecated-declarations] drivers/media/pci/zoran/zoran_driver.c:347:5: warning: 'virt_to_bus' is deprecated (declared at arch/alpha/include/asm/io.h:114) [-Wdeprecated-declarations] drivers/media/pci/zoran/zoran_driver.c:366:6: warning: 'virt_to_bus' is deprecated (declared at arch/alpha/include/asm/io.h:114) [-Wdeprecated-declarations] Warning(include/linux/mtd/nand.h:587): Excess struct/union/enum/typedef member 'ecclayout' description in 'nand_chip' drivers/block/skd_main.c:4584:17: warning: format '%lu' expects argument of type 'long unsigned int', but argument 5 has type 'unsigned int' [-Wformat=] drivers/block/skd_main.c:4584:17: warning: format '%lu' expects argument of type 'long unsigned int', but argument 7 has type 'unsigned int' [-Wformat=] drivers/block/skd_main.c:4610:25: warning: cast from pointer to integer of different size [-Wpointer-to-int-cast] drivers/block/skd_main.c:4613:27: warning: cast from pointer to integer of different size [-Wpointer-to-int-cast] drivers/block/skd_main.c:4613:20: warning: cast to pointer from integer of different size [-Wint-to-pointer-cast] drivers/block/skd_main.c:4638:17: warning: format '%lu' expects argument of type 'long unsigned int', but argument 5 has type 'unsigned int' [-Wformat=] drivers/block/skd_main.c:4638:17: warning: format '%lu' expects argument of type 'long unsigned int', but argument 7 has type 'unsigned int' [-Wformat=] drivers/block/skd_main.c:4649:42: warning: format '%lu' expects argument of type 'long unsigned int', but argument 6 has type 'unsigned int' [-Wformat=] drivers/block/skd_main.c:4649:42: warning: format '%lu' expects argument of type 'long unsigned int', but argument 7 has type 'unsigned int' [-Wformat=] drivers/block/skd_main.c:4695:17: warning: format '%lu' expects argument of type 'long unsigned int', but argument 5 has type 'unsigned int' [-Wformat=] drivers/block/skd_main.c:4695:17: warning: format '%lu' expects argument of type 'long unsigned int', but argument 7 has type 'unsigned int' [-Wformat=] drivers/block/skd_main.c:1171:7: warning: unused variable 'cpu' [-Wunused-variable] include/linux/sysfs.h:426:1: warning: 'sysfs_get_dirent_ns' used but never defined [enabled by default] drivers/block/skd_main.c:5324:4: warning: passing argument 1 of 'iounmap' discards 'volatile' qualifier from pointer target type [enabled by default] drivers/block/skd_main.c:5487:4: warning: passing argument 1 of 'iounmap' discards 'volatile' qualifier from pointer target type [enabled by default] drivers/block/skd_main.c:1120:3: warning: format '%llx' expects argument of type 'long long unsigned int', but argument 7 has type 'dma_addr_t' [-Wformat] drivers/block/skd_main.c:1256:3: warning: format '%llx' expects argument of type 'long long unsigned int', but argument 7 has type 'dma_addr_t' [-Wformat] drivers/block/skd_main.c:1936:3: warning: format '%llx' expects argument of type 'long long unsigned int', but argument 7 has type 'dma_addr_t' [-Wformat] drivers/block/skd_main.c:2486:2: warning: format '%llx' expects argument of type 'long long unsigned int', but argument 5 has type 'dma_addr_t' [-Wformat] drivers/block/skd_main.c:2548:3: warning: format '%llx' expects argument of type 'long long unsigned int', but argument 8 has type 'dma_addr_t' [-Wformat] net/ipv6/ndisc.c:1730:1: warning: label 'out' defined but not used [-Wunused-label] [sparse] drivers/md/bcache/journal.c:660:29: sparse: context imbalance in 'journal_wait_for_write' - wrong count at exit drivers/md/bcache/journal.c:741:9: sparse: context imbalance in 'bch_journal' - unexpected unlock drivers/md/bcache/btree.c:2172:5: sparse: symbol 'btree_insert_fn' was not declared. Should it be static? drivers/block/skd_main.c:384:19: sparse: symbol 'skd_flush_slab' was not declared. Should it be static? drivers/block/skd_main.c:921:24: sparse: incorrect type in assignment (different base types) @@ expected unsigned int [unsigned] [usertype] be_lba @@ got ed int [unsigned] [usertype] be_lba @@ drivers/block/skd_main.c:922:26: sparse: incorrect type in assignment (different base types) @@ expected unsigned int [unsigned] [usertype] be_count @@ got ed int [unsigned] [usertype] be_count @@ drivers/block/skd_main.c:923:25: sparse: incorrect type in assignment (different base types) @@ expected unsigned long long [unsigned] [usertype] be_dmaa @@ got g long [unsigned] [usertype] be_dmaa @@ drivers/block/skd_main.c:978:49: sparse: incorrect type in assignment (different base types) @@ expected unsigned int [unsigned] [usertype] sg_list_len_bytes @@ got ed int [unsigned] [usertype] sg_list_len_bytes @@ drivers/block/skd_main.c:2039:51: sparse: incorrect type in assignment (different base types) @@ expected unsigned long long [unsigned] [usertype] sg_list_dma_address @@ got g long [unsigned] [usertype] sg_list_dma_address @@ drivers/block/skd_main.c:2042:41: sparse: incorrect type in assignment (different base types) @@ expected unsigned int [unsigned] [usertype] sg_list_len_bytes @@ got ed int [unsigned] [usertype] sg_list_len_bytes @@ drivers/block/skd_main.c:2112:18: sparse: cast to restricted __be32 drivers/block/skd_main.c:2112:18: sparse: cast to restricted __be32 drivers/block/skd_main.c:2112:18: sparse: cast to restricted __be32 drivers/block/skd_main.c:2112:18: sparse: cast to restricted __be32 drivers/block/skd_main.c:2112:18: sparse: cast to restricted __be32 drivers/block/skd_main.c:2112:18: sparse: cast to restricted __be32 drivers/block/skd_main.c:1626:27: sparse: incorrect type in initializer (different address spaces) @@ expected void [noderef] <asn:1>*p @@ got sn:1>*p @@ drivers/block/skd_main.c:2192:39: sparse: incorrect type in assignment (different base types) @@ expected unsigned long long [unsigned] [usertype] sg_list_dma_address @@ got g long [unsigned] [usertype] sg_list_dma_address @@ drivers/block/skd_main.c:2239:45: sparse: incorrect type in assignment (different base types) @@ expected unsigned int [unsigned] [usertype] sg_list_len_bytes @@ got ed int [unsigned] [usertype] sg_list_len_bytes @@ drivers/block/skd_main.c:2248:45: sparse: incorrect type in assignment (different base types) @@ expected unsigned int [unsigned] [usertype] sg_list_len_bytes @@ got ed int [unsigned] [usertype] sg_list_len_bytes @@ drivers/block/skd_main.c:2263:45: sparse: incorrect type in assignment (different base types) @@ expected unsigned int [unsigned] [usertype] sg_list_len_bytes @@ got ed int [unsigned] [usertype] sg_list_len_bytes @@ drivers/block/skd_main.c:2275:45: sparse: incorrect type in assignment (different base types) @@ expected unsigned int [unsigned] [usertype] sg_list_len_bytes @@ got ed int [unsigned] [usertype] sg_list_len_bytes @@ drivers/block/skd_main.c:2863:25: sparse: cast to restricted __be32 drivers/block/skd_main.c:2863:25: sparse: cast to restricted __be32 drivers/block/skd_main.c:2863:25: sparse: cast to restricted __be32 drivers/block/skd_main.c:2863:25: sparse: cast to restricted __be32 drivers/block/skd_main.c:2863:25: sparse: cast to restricted __be32 drivers/block/skd_main.c:2863:25: sparse: cast to restricted __be32 drivers/block/skd_main.c:2865:25: sparse: cast to restricted __be32 drivers/block/skd_main.c:2865:25: sparse: cast to restricted __be32 drivers/block/skd_main.c:2865:25: sparse: cast to restricted __be32 drivers/block/skd_main.c:2865:25: sparse: cast to restricted __be32 drivers/block/skd_main.c:2865:25: sparse: cast to restricted __be32 drivers/block/skd_main.c:2865:25: sparse: cast to restricted __be32 drivers/block/skd_main.c:2933:37: sparse: incorrect type in assignment (different base types) @@ expected unsigned short [unsigned] [addressable] [assigned] [usertype] pcie_bus_number @@ got sable] [assigned] [usertype] pcie_bus_number @@ drivers/block/skd_main.c:2938:36: sparse: incorrect type in assignment (different base types) @@ expected unsigned short [unsigned] [addressable] [assigned] [usertype] pcie_vendor_id @@ got sable] [assigned] [usertype] pcie_vendor_id @@ drivers/block/skd_main.c:2941:36: sparse: incorrect type in assignment (different base types) @@ expected unsigned short [unsigned] [addressable] [assigned] [usertype] pcie_device_id @@ got sable] [assigned] [usertype] pcie_device_id @@ drivers/block/skd_main.c:2945:46: sparse: incorrect type in assignment (different base types) @@ expected unsigned short [unsigned] [addressable] [assigned] [usertype] pcie_subsystem_vendor_id @@ got sable] [assigned] [usertype] pcie_subsystem_vendor_id @@ drivers/block/skd_main.c:2948:46: sparse: incorrect type in assignment (different base types) @@ expected unsigned short [unsigned] [addressable] [assigned] [usertype] pcie_subsystem_device_id @@ got sable] [assigned] [usertype] pcie_subsystem_device_id @@ drivers/block/skd_main.c:2971:25: sparse: incorrect type in assignment (different base types) @@ expected unsigned short [unsigned] [addressable] [assigned] [usertype] page_length @@ got sable] [assigned] [usertype] page_length @@ drivers/block/skd_main.c:2982:17: sparse: cast to restricted __be32 drivers/block/skd_main.c:2982:17: sparse: cast to restricted __be32 drivers/block/skd_main.c:2982:17: sparse: cast to restricted __be32 drivers/block/skd_main.c:2982:17: sparse: cast to restricted __be32 drivers/block/skd_main.c:2982:17: sparse: cast to restricted __be32 drivers/block/skd_main.c:2982:17: sparse: cast to restricted __be32 drivers/block/skd_main.c:3056:29: sparse: cast to restricted __be32 drivers/block/skd_main.c:3056:29: sparse: cast to restricted __be32 drivers/block/skd_main.c:3056:29: sparse: cast to restricted __be32 drivers/block/skd_main.c:3056:29: sparse: cast to restricted __be32 drivers/block/skd_main.c:3056:29: sparse: cast to restricted __be32 drivers/block/skd_main.c:3056:29: sparse: cast to restricted __be32 drivers/block/skd_main.c:5355:34: sparse: cast removes address space of expression drivers/block/skd_main.c:5355:34: sparse: incorrect type in argument 1 (different address spaces) @@ expected void volatile [noderef] <asn:2>*addr @@ got latile [noderef] <asn:2>*addr @@ drivers/block/skd_main.c:5386:34: sparse: cast removes address space of expression drivers/block/skd_main.c:5386:34: sparse: incorrect type in argument 1 (different address spaces) @@ expected void volatile [noderef] <asn:2>*addr @@ got latile [noderef] <asn:2>*addr @@ drivers/block/skd_main.c:5626:12: sparse: symbol 'skd_skmsg_state_to_str' was not declared. Should it be static? drivers/block/skd_main.c:5638:12: sparse: symbol 'skd_skreq_state_to_str' was not declared. Should it be static? drivers/gpu/drm/radeon/rs780_dpm.c:1003:5: sparse: symbol 'rs780_dpm_force_performance_level' was not declared. Should it be static? drivers/gpu/drm/radeon/trinity_dpm.c:1071:6: sparse: symbol 'trinity_dpm_enable_bapm' was not declared. Should it be static? fs/sysfs/mount.c:110:48: sparse: undefined identifier 'type' [coccinelle] drivers/block/skd_main.c:4938:9-14: ERROR: reference preceded by free on line 4936 drivers/md/bcache/journal.c:679:3-9: preceding lock on line 668 drivers/md/bcache/journal.c:679:3-9: preceding lock on line 668 drivers/md/bcache/journal.c:679:3-9: preceding lock on line 707 drivers/md/bcache/request.c:935:1-7: Replace memcpy with struct assignment --- 0-DAY kernel build testing backend Open Source Technology Center http://lists.01.org/mailman/listinfo/kbuild Intel Corporation -- To unsubscribe from this list: send the line "unsubscribe kernel-janitors"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html